Elf (2003) | PG | Family/Comedy

Buddy is a human who has spent his whole life living in the North Pole, raised by Santa’s elves. When he finds out that he is not an elf, Buddy sets out on a journey to New York, where he searches for his biological father and finds out what it really means to be human.

Available to watch on Now TV

Home Alone (1990) | PG | Family/Comedy

When Kevin is forgotten at home after his entire family leave for the Christmas holidays, he can’t wait to live by his own rules. That is, until his house is targeted by thieves who try to break in. Kevin must create a series of traps and challenges to defend his home.

This movie is part of a series that can be streamed all together.

Available to watch on Disney+

The Grinch (2018) | U | Family/Comedy

In the animated Christmas classic, the Grinch is unhappy with the festive cheer in Whoville village, so he and his dog set to work on ruining Christmas.

Available to watch on Now TV

The Holiday (2006) | 12A | Comedy/Romance

Fed up with their tragic love lives, two women living completely different lives swap homes for the holidays. In a funny coincidence, they each end up meeting a local who will change their lives.

Available to watch on BBC iPlayer

Let It Snow (2019) | 12 | Comedy/Romance

A snowstorm hits a small midwestern town on Christmas Eve, bringing together a group of high school students. By the next day, they will find love and form new friendships that will change their Christmas.

Available to watch on Netflix

The Christmas Chronicles (2018) | PG | Family/Comedy

This is the story of Kate and Teddy Pierce, two siblings who plan to catch Santa Claus on camera on Christmas Eve. The plan turns into a journey that most kids dream about as they work with Santa and his elves to save the holidays.

Available to watch on Netflix

Love Actually (2003) | 15 | Comedy/Romance

This feel-good film follows eight couples who are all at different stages of their lives. In the days leading up to Christmas in London, they encounter different aspects of love, sharing tender memories and navigating big life events.

Available to watch on Netflix or to rent via Amazon Prime

The Princess Switch (2018) | PG | Comedy/Romance

A week before Christmas, a small-town baker travels to the kingdom of Belgravia to participate in a competition. When she runs into the Duchess, who looks exactly like her, they decide to switch lives for the week. Becoming each other has big consequences when both end up falling for someone important in each other’s lives.

This movie is part of a series that can be streamed all together.

Available to watch on Netflix
